The Cost of Obfuscation When Reporting Locations of Cases in Syndromic Surveillance Systems
Content Type: Abstract
In a classical surveillance system one looks for disturbances in the number of cases, but in a spatio-temporal system, not only the number of cases observed but also where they are located is reported.
